There are 5 major blue ribbon trout streams
within an hour drive of . The Madison, Gallatin, Big
Hole, Yellowstone and Jefferson Rivers. The
smaller spring fed creeks and streams are all
very productive as well. The local guides know
the details!!! We can help you with fishing
guides, horseback ridding outfitters and more.
The town of
is only one mile west. Often called the the
town of Ennis will be the starting point for
all your activities on the Madison River. This
“good-time” western town has good
restaurants, bars, fly shops, antiques shops,
art galleries, specialty shops, churches, realtors
and fuel filling stations. The town is full
of cowboys, anglers and outdoor recreationists.
The Western flavor is for real here as the area
ranch-lands are still very much cattle country.
There’s plenty of action along Ennis’s
boardwalks in the summer and fall hunting seasons.
